IP Country City ISP
178.132.107.44 Italy Castro dei Volsci Frosinone Wireless S.p.A.
212.59.111.177 Russia Moscow JSC Evrasia Telecom Ru
77.207.124.70 France Paris SFR
79.127.134.15 Czechia Ipex Ltd.
89.107.99.249 Kazakhstan Almaty BTcom Infocommunications Ltd.
89.35.25.159 Romania Vem Solutions, LLC